He’s Scottish, and Rangers need more Scottish players. I wouldn’t be surprised if links to more Scottish players started to surface.
Of the 25 man European squads 8 must be Scottish. Souttar, McAusland, and Scott Wright are the only senior players we have left that are Scottish. McLaughlin and Jack just went, and McCrorie wants to leave for first-team football. Beyond that we’ll need to register youth players like King and Devine which is difficult because you would rather these lads are out on loan getting regular football.
There needs to be Scots brought in at some point. Even if it is just a couple of additions. I really hope we go for that boy Watson at Kilmarnock because he had a real breakout season.

Generic, I agree with your sentiment about needing more Scots. However, Conway is English and qualifies to play for Scotland through his grandfather. I believe he’s spent his career to date in England so there would be no benefit in terms of home-grown status for UEFA competitions.
4.) 11 Jun 2024 14:39:21
Generic, players don't need to be Scottish - they need to be homegrown or association trained - and I don't think Conway classes as the later as he came through an English academy.
